This message concerns HHSS students who are required to complete the OSSLT (Literacy Test) this school year. Please find the group that pertains to you and read carefully:

GROUP 1

HHSS Students (grade 10, 11, non-graduating 12’s) enrolled in the Remote Learning Program (RLP)

  • Students enrolled in the Secondary Remote Learning Program (SRLP) will not be writing the Ontario Secondary School Literacy Test (OSSLT) this year. It is the Ministry of Education’s expectation that students who are writing the OSSLT must do so in-person; therefore, students in SRLP will be offered other opportunities to fulfill the literacy graduation requirement.
    • Grade 11 and non-graduating Grade 12 students in SRLP will either take the Ontario Secondary School Literacy Course (OLC4OI) or participate in the adjudication process.
    • Remote learning Grade 10 students will be deferred for this year and given opportunities to fulfill this requirement next year.

GROUP 2

HHSS Students (grade 11, non-graduating gr12’s currently in gr11 classes) enrolled in In-Person Learning at HHSS or a Congregated Program at another site.

  • The 2021/22 OSSLT will be completed online for those eligible to write it.
  • The test will be written in class and is broken into 2 sessions with a short break in between.
  • Each “session” will take approximately 60 minutes to complete.
  • All Lit Test activities will take place in PERIOD C in a regularly scheduled day.
  • There is no modified schedule for Lit Test days. All students are expected to attend their regularly scheduled classes.

The following dates relate to all group 2 students at HHSS:

  • Nov 10: Practice Test (all period C, grade 11 classes will write).
  • Nov 23-25: Literacy Test dates (period C, grade 11 classes divided over 3 days).

GROUP 3

HHSS Students currently in grade 10 enrolled in In-Person Learning at HHSS or a Congregated Program at another site.

  • All Grade 10 students enrolled in In-Person Learning will complete the OSSLT at HHSS in March, 2022.
